Eleven of Whanganui's finest summer gardens will feature in this weekend's Anniversary Amble.

Organised by the Whanganui branch of Arthritis New Zealand, the annual garden tour is part of Vintage Weekend and takes place from 10am to 4pm on Monday.

As well as enjoying the gardens, there will be stalls, raffles and refreshments on offer for visitors.

Tickets cost $15 and are available from the Whanganui i-Site, St Johns Pharmacy, Mitre 10 Mega and all Whanganui garden centres. Details of the gardens are included with the ticket. Proceeds go to Arthritis New Zealand's Whanganui branch.
